我正在开发的React本地应用程序,显示视频。我用的是react-native-video包。当视频页面打开时,视频将自动开始一次,视频结束后不应重复。它在Android上运行良好,但在iOS上,视频自动从头开始,并不断重复。这是我的代码停止视频后,视频结束:
const onEnd = () => {
setState({ ...state, play: false, showControls: true });
if (videoRef.current) {
videoRef.current.seek(0);
}
};
我该如何解决这个问题?
2条答案
按热度按时间bxgwgixi1#
我通过删除这行代码解决了这个问题。保持当前视频时间在最大持续时间,不要设置为0,这将使无限重复条件。
xfb7svmp2#
你现在可以走了。希望这将有助于